      Saw it. Was good, not great.

      Pros:
      -Well shot and edited.
      -Great practical effects. So glad there was little to no CGI.
      -Interesting setup that maybe makes more sense than the original did.
      -Generally competent acting.

      Cons:
      -Stupid or otherwise uninteresting/unengaging characters, other than Mia.
      -These "friends" acted more like enemies throughout the movie.
      -Entirely too serious, would have liked if they'd stuck to the wackiness of Evil Dead 2, but ymmv on this one. It's just personal taste.
      -The "final boss" was completely underwhelming. I was expecting a bigger, more imposing deadite of some kind. Instead, what we got was something that made me think that they ran out of money or something.

        I haven't had as much fun watching a movie as I have Evil Dead in a long time. Though darker and scarier than the original film(messier too) it sets a standard that I haven't seen any remakes ever do. It goes above and beyond referencing the original series and expands up on it in its own small ways beautifully. Its very much its own movie, despite following the a large chunk of the original. The last little shot after the credits made me smile all the way home.

        The only con I can think of is that the final confrontation, wasn't as much of a confrontation as I would have liked...but then again, remember the rules of the book, it needed a specific number, and it didn't get that number.(making sure I don't get too specific on any spoilers). The characters were well written, even though they didn't get any major character development, they got enough for you to feel for them when the shit went down as well as stand out individually. For people who complaining that they were "bland", real people are "bland" to real people, I appreciated seeing characters who weren't completely stupid and tried to be rational in the situations they were put in.

        Which makes the pay off stronger in the end when people are faced against something that they cant explain.

        All the references and homages to the original films were beautifully done and I think I caught about 3/4ths of them. I was literally a kid looking for Easter eggs and I got my fair share.

        Anyone who is a fan of the original series, and hated this film, needs to go back and watch the originals again.This film is more serious in tone, hell is DEAD serious in its tone...But a real fan of the series is going to watch whats going on and laugh at it, because the dark twisted humor of the originals is mixed in here. Its not overt, in fact its pretty subtle at times.

        But its there, Fede Alvarez blew me away and left me wanting more. Thats all any Evil Dead fan should ask for.

        Definitely buying this on DVD the instant I can, I went in expecting to see an Evil Dead film, and I got one hell of an Evil Dead film.
